Molinicos, Albacete, Spain

Overview

Molinicos is a picturesque mountain village in Albacete, Spain, set amidst pine forests and rolling hills. Known for its tranquil atmosphere and authentic rural Spanish culture, it offers travelers a slower pace and scenic nature. The town's compact size and friendly community make it perfect for an immersive local experience.

Best Time to Visit

April-June and September-October offer mild weather and fewer crowds.

Local Tips

Bring comfortable shoes for walking hilly streets and forest trails. Most shops close during the afternoon siesta, so plan meals and shopping ahead.

Cultural Etiquette

Tipping is modest (round up or leave small change). Dress casually but respectfully, especially at local fiestas. Greet locals with a friendly 'hola' or 'buenos días'.

Safety Warnings

Molinicos is very safe with virtually no serious crime. Take care when hiking, as some trails can be steep and poorly marked, carry water and a map.

Hidden Gems

Discover the Rural Museum, explore lesser-known hiking routes in Sierra del Segura, and visit the old washhouse (lavadero) for insight into village traditions.
